How it works
Booking and arrest procedures are an essential part of a law enforcement agency's operations. When a person is arrested, they are typically taken to a detention facility, such as a jail or holding cell. At the facility, they are booked, which involves processing the individual's personal and biographical information, taking fingerprints, and photographing them. This information is then entered into a database, which helps law enforcement agencies track and identify individuals.
Booking Process
The booking process typically includes the following steps:
-
Fingerprinting
-
Photographing
-
Collecting personal and biographical information
-
Entering the individual's information into a database
Arrest Procedures
Arrest procedures vary depending on the circumstances of the arrest. In general, an arrest occurs when a law enforcement officer has probable cause to believe that an individual has committed a crime. The officer will then take the individual into custody and transport them to a detention facility for booking.

Common Questions
- What happens after an arrest?
After an arrest, the individual is taken to a detention facility for booking. They will then be held until they can be arraigned in court or released on bail.
- Can I access booking records?
Yes, in most states, booking records are considered public information and can be accessed through a public records request.
- What is the difference between a booking and an arrest?
A booking is the process of processing an individual's information at a detention facility, while an arrest is the act of taking an individual into custody.

Common Misconceptions
- Arrests are only made for serious crimes.
Arrests can be made for a wide range of crimes, from minor infractions to serious felonies.
- Booking records are not public information.
In most states, booking records are considered public information and can be accessed through a public records request.
